Mills Fleet Farm e-Commerce Enterprises, LLC is seeking an Auto Service Advisor to assist customers, determine vehicle needs, verify warranty coverage, and develop service estimates. You will manage repair orders, schedule appointments, and promote automotive products while delivering outstanding service.
This role involves answering inquiries, learning Fleet Farm’s tire, parts, and accessories lines, and performing light maintenance tasks as needed.
